Residential building permits · 2015–2025
| Year | Units | Valuation |
|---|---|---|
| 2025 | 153 | $40,964,371 |
| 2024 | 159 | $41,443,498 |
| 2023 | 125 | $30,398,685 |
| 2022 | 126 | $26,365,151 |
| 2021 | 124 | $29,467,107 |
| 2020 | 101 | $18,603,156 |
| 2019 | 75 | $15,599,032 |
| 2018 | 77 | $13,181,443 |
| 2017 | 69 | $12,647,190 |
| 2016 | 62 | $10,987,930 |
| 2015 | 41 | $6,638,536 |
The Census Building Permits Survey counts new privately-owned housing units authorized by building permits — a leading indicator of housing supply. "1-unit" is single-family; "5+ units" is larger multifamily. Figures are imputation-adjusted to cover permit offices that did not report.
